Abstract:
Accurate measurement of a signal at extremely high data rates such as OC192 is accomplished, to provide a high dynamic range. A data receiver comprises a limiting amplifier comprising a plurality of amplifier stages. A peak detector measures a voltage level of an input to the limiting amplifier. An input to the peak detector is connected directly to an input of a first stage of the limiting amplifier. Transmission lines used between the input to the peak detector and the input of the first stage of the limiting amplifier are impedance matched such that the peak detector appears as a load with insignificant capacitance with respect to the extremely high data rate of a signal on the input. Also, a same bias is provided to both the input stage of the limiting amplifier as well as to the peak detector.
Abstract:
A write head for a magnetic storage system energizes a write coil for a plurality of bit intervals and selectively shutters the magnetic field to alter a magnetic domain of a magnetic storage medium for each bit interval. The position of the shutter may be controlled using a micro-electro mechanical system. Magnetic pole segments provide a loop between the write coil and the magnetic storage medium. Magnetic shielding on the shutter mechanisms controls the reflection of the magnetic fields. In a rewritable magnetic storage system, a first write coil generates a positive magnetic field and a second write coil generates a negative magnetic field. A shutter is associated with each write coil to selectively allow the positive or negative magnetic fields to alter the magnetic domain of the magnetic storage medium. The positive or negative magnetic fields can alter the magnetic domain in a collocated region of the magnetic storage medium to avoid jitter.
Abstract:
Disclosed are various embodiments of bypass circuits that can be used with series connected LED strings for backlighting circuits in LCD displays. The bypass circuits can also be used for other implementations of series wired LED strings. The bypass circuit may comprise a latch, such as a silicon controlled rectifier that is connected to the output of a comparator circuit that compares the voltage at the cathode of an LED in the LED string to a reference voltage. In this manner, a circuit is created around each LED that is burned out.

Abstract:
In described embodiments, elements of a wireless home network employ learned power security for the network. An access point, router, or other wireless base station emits and receives signals having corresponding signal strengths. Wireless devices coupled to the base station through a radio link are moved through the home network at boundary points of the home and the signal strength is measured at each device and communicated to the base station. Based on the signal strength information from the emitted signals measured at the boundary points and/or from measured signal strength information of signals received from the boundary points, the base station determines a network secure area. The base station declines permission of devices attempting to use or join the home network that exhibit signal strength characteristics less than boundary values for the network secure area.
Abstract:
In described embodiments, automatic de-emphasis setting is provided for driving a capacitive backplane. Line impedance and line length of a transmission (TX) device are measured that form a load impedance of a driver. For some exemplary embodiments, the line impedance is predominantly a line capacitance, and such embodiments detect this capacitance. Measured line impedance is converted to a control signal (such as, for example, a three bit digital control signal) which automatically sets the de-emphasis of the TX stage. With the amount of capacitance and the length of the transmission line, the appropriate de-emphasis settings might be determined, and such de-emphasis setting be applied by the transmitter to the driver to compensate for transmission line effects.

Abstract:
An amplifier includes a signal splitter operable to receive an input signal and generate at least first and second split signals, a first amplifier adapted to receive the first split signal and to generate a first amplified signal, and a second amplifier adapted to receive the second split signal and to generate a second amplified signal. A combining circuit is adapted to generate an output signal which is a sum of the first amplified signal and the second amplified signal. The amplifier further includes a phase control circuit arranged in a signal path of one of the first and second amplifiers, the phase control circuit comprising at least one thin film ferroelectric element. The amount of phase shift provided by the phase control circuit is selectively variable as a function of a control signal applied thereto.
